Twist has a problem. His Newark, New Jersey neighborhood is under siege in a bloody turf war that has spun out of control. As one of the leaders of the Skulls, Twist devises a last-ditch attempt to end the war by kidnapping a high-ranking member of the rival gang with the hope of forcing them into submissions. However, his plan doesn't turn out as expected. When negotiations deteriorate and violence escalate, the only recourse left is the execution of the hostage. As a volatile situation grows more explosive by the hour, the lines between right and wrong blur. And for Twist, resolution comes at a price. Still Black Remains captures the struggle to realize the American Dream in a landscape filled with desperation, anger, and futility -- where the only choices are violent ones.
